在這里學(xué)什么?
In today’s tech-saturated global marketplace, businesses can’t survive without a strong team of computer information systems experts. That means jobs in this field are some of the fastest growing positions in management, and provide attractive salaries for new and experienced professionals. In fact, "Money Magazine" consistently ranks this major as one of the hottest degree fields in America based on employment growth, job independence, and job security.
But a degree in computer information systems isn’t just about the money. As a highly skilled technology professional, you can expect to become an invaluable contributor by helping companies understand and harness technology to stay competitive in the marketplace. You’ll be responsible for planning, developing, and managing computer technologies that support all business functions.
This major suits you if you are passionate about cutting-edge technologies and seeking management opportunities. The computer information systems major focuses on business firms and their operations. It considers technology as a strategic tool to empower business success.

Major Requirements
As a computer information systems major, you’ll gain real-world skills in a variety of areas, including systems analysis and design, database design, and network management. This major is organized into four groups of courses:
- University Core Curriculum
- 14 undergraduate business foundation courses
- specialized computer information systems coursework
- nine credits of electives
Your degree path begins your freshman and sophomore year as a pre-business major before declaring as a computer information systems major your junior year.
Courses
A few of the classes you will take include:
- Business Systems Application Development
- Project Management
- Computer Networks for Business
- Information Systems Security
- Business Process Analysis and Design
What Can You Do with a Degree in Computer Information Systems?
The career of computer information systems is considered by many as "recession proof,” with more jobs than graduates. Companies have a constant, high demand for computer information systems professionals who can help them better utilize computer technologies to enhance business operations and achieve improved performance.
Positions include:
- systems analyst
- network/LAN administrator
- database administrator
- network systems and data communications analyst
- database administrator
- computer support specialist
- business analyst
- project manager

中國學(xué)生入學(xué)要求
為來自中國的學(xué)生設(shè)計 You should apply as a freshman undergraduate student if: you have completed or will complete high school or secondary school before the semester you apply to start; you have not attended a university, college, or other postsecondary institution; you wish to earn a bachelor’s degree. Required Scores to demonstrate English Proficiency: TOEFL iBT 79; IELTS 6.5 Band; Pearson's PTE 53
